pub struct TrimEndHelper;
Expand description
Return a string trim only at the end by a definable parameter (’ ’ by default)
assert_eq!(
exec_template(json!({ "temp": " test " }), "{{trim_end temp}}"),
" test"
);
assert_eq!(
exec_template(json!({ "temp": "/test/" }), "{{trim_end temp \"/\"}}"),
"/test"
);
Trait Implementations§
Source§impl HelperDef for TrimEndHelper
impl HelperDef for TrimEndHelper
Source§fn call_inner<'reg: 'rc, 'rc>(
&self,
h: &Helper<'reg, 'rc>,
_: &'reg Handlebars<'reg>,
_: &'rc Context,
_: &mut RenderContext<'reg, 'rc>,
) -> Result<ScopedJson<'reg, 'rc>, RenderError>
fn call_inner<'reg: 'rc, 'rc>( &self, h: &Helper<'reg, 'rc>, _: &'reg Handlebars<'reg>, _: &'rc Context, _: &mut RenderContext<'reg, 'rc>, ) -> Result<ScopedJson<'reg, 'rc>, RenderError>
A simplified api to define helper Read more
Auto Trait Implementations§
impl Freeze for TrimEndHelper
impl RefUnwindSafe for TrimEndHelper
impl Send for TrimEndHelper
impl Sync for TrimEndHelper
impl Unpin for TrimEndHelper
impl UnwindSafe for TrimEndHelper
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more